windows 8 and minecraft?

nanny is buying my son a laptop for xmas, he asked for windows 7 as he wantsto play minecraft and has been told by friends it wont work on 8, has anyone got any idea as have been on the minecraft forums and so confused

    Minecraft is written in Java. It'll run on any computer capable of running the Java VM. i.e. Windows, MacOS and certain versions of Unix/Linux.

    Java is officially supported on Windows 8. They have some helpful advice here though it's mostly advice about switching between desktop and metro in Win8 since Java only runs in desktop mode.

    Edit: LOL Oracle (the current maintainers of Java) even have an FAQ entry about Minecraft. I guess Minecraft is one of the few valid reasons a home user should even have Java installed these days!

    Edit: I should probably add that the biggest thing that will affect the performance of Minecraft is the graphics hardware in the laptop. Intel HD graphics, found in lower end graphics will be a bit slow but not too bad, higher end dedicated graphics from nVidia or ATI will run a lot better and will also be necessary for other big name games.
